1971 Plymouth Barracuda

Today’s car is a 1971 Plymouth Barracuda Gran Coupe owned by Rip Masters. Rip is the second owner since 1998. It is finished in Lemon Twist Yellow with a Black vinyl top, with a Black interior and a Shaker hood. I saw this car at Caffein Cruisers Cars and Coffee located in Torrance, CA. It is powered by a 408 cu in stroker, 6.68 liter V8, with a Carter 4 bbl carburetor, producing 470 hp. Power is sent to the rear wheels through a 3-speed TorqueFlite automatic transmission and delivering that power to the rear wheels through a Sure Grip limited slip rear end with a 3.55 to 1 gear ratio. Helping slow it down are disc brakes. The front suspension is independent with torsion bars, a sway bar and in rear is asymmetrical semi-elliptical leaf springs. The car came fully optioned with air condition, power steering, power disc brakes, Rambo steering wheel, six way power seats, luggage rack and rally wheels. The original MSRP was $3,029. The total number of 1971 Plymouth Barracuda produced was 16,492 of which 1,331 were Gran Coupe’s.
